I've got several pairs, they're a good few year old and lasting really well. Look like new.
Defeet seem to be most durable.
Pearl Izumi have quite a diverse range but quality is variable - a couple of mine have gone saggy round the ankles, others havent.
Sockguy seem to have most range but the image quality and material is poor - toes and ankles went pretty quick in mine.
Old sock guys seem to be better than moderns imho ....i had one pair from years ago that prompted me to buy in bulk ......
